I've encountered following behavior with painting the terrain multiple times: I am creating a new terrain, a flat one, and import some paints for it, say, GrassGreen_A and RoadStones_A. When I start painting with them, everything goes well until I encounter a strip of the terrain which it simply refuses to paint over, regardless of brush settings. I just mouse all over it and it stays bare. Is it something that's intended but I don't understand yet?

EDIT: With some experimenting I figured out that it seems like the paint tool seems to think the mouse cursor is not where I think it is. Namely, when I try to paint one area, grass suddenly appears in another, several meters away, and the same thing with deleting. It's like there is some kind of invisible offset but I am sure I didn't set it.

OK, I think I figured it out. The paint tool seems to have this problem with terrains that a) are smaller than the default 64x64 cells, b) have non-square "resolutions" (i.e. rectangle), and c) have dimensions that are not powers of 2. I was having this problem in particular on my 50x30 terrain, but my old 64x64 never had it. Such things would be nice to know before I created most of the level on a faulty terrain. :-/

I also noticed something strange: I don't seem to be able to create terrains of sizes slightly larger than 64x64, e.g. 90x70: the resulting terrains always default to 64x64. I can, however, create a 300x300 terrain, which is weird.
